How does Keris function?
Keris provides a platform for individuals willing to participate in Institutional Review Board (IRB) approved research studies, allowing them to gather, preserve, and share their health data with investigators. As a participant in a research study, you may be mandated to provide specific data, information, or permissions to register, as stated in your Informed Consent Form. For more details, refer to your Informed Consent Form. Keris has the right to restrict service access to certain individuals who are actively participating or are involved in clinical trials or other research studies. No Medical Advice; Not for Emergencies
Keris does not offer medical advice or diagnoses, or engage in the practice of medicine. Our Services are not intended to be a substitute for professional medical advice, diagnosis, or treatment and are offered for informational and communicative purposes only. The Services are not intended to be, and must not be taken to be, the practice of medicine, nursing, pharmacy, or other healthcare advice by Keris.
The Services are not meant to diagnose or treat any conditions—only your medical professional can determine the right course of treatment for you and determine what is safe, appropriate, and effective based on your needs. Keris is not responsible for the accuracy of information and materials it obtains from others and utilizes as part of the Services. If you receive an independent clinical review from a medical professional through the Services, Keris is not responsible for the accuracy or appropriateness of the medical professional’s care or communications. You understand that by accessing or using the Services, you are not entering into a provider-patient relationship with Keris. You are solely responsible for any decisions or actions you take based on the information and materials available through the Services.
You acknowledge that although some User Content (defined below) may be provided by individuals in the medical profession, the provision of such User Content does not create a medical professional/patient relationship between you and Keris or between you and any other individual or entity, and does not constitute an opinion, medical advice, or diagnosis or treatment. Healthcare providers and patients should always obtain applicable diagnostic information from appropriate trusted sources.
THE SERVICES SHOULD NEVER BE USED AS A SUBSTITUTE FOR EMERGENCY CARE. IF YOU THINK YOU MAY HAVE A MEDICAL OR MENTAL HEALTH EMERGENCY, YOU SHOULD SEEK EMERGENCY TREATMENT AT THE NEAREST EMERGENCY ROOM OR DIAL 911.

Children’s Online Privacy Protection Act
The Children’s Online Privacy Protection Act (“COPPA”) requires that online service providers obtain parental consent before they knowingly collect personally identifiable information online from children who are under 16 years of age.
We do not knowingly collect or solicit personally identifiable information from children under 16 years of age; if you are under 16 years of age, please do not attempt to register for or otherwise use the Services or send us any personal information. If we learn we have collected personal information from a child under 16 years of age, we will delete that information as quickly as possible. If you believe that a child under 16 years of age may have provided us personal information, please contact us at support@keris.ai.
